Question
119, 145, 186, 249, 340,
483 Find the wrong number in the given number seriesSolution
ATQ, 119 + 13 Γ 2 = 145 145 + 13 Γ 3 = 184 184 + 13 Γ 5 = 249 249 + 13 Γ 7 = 340 340 + 13 Γ 11 = 483 The given series is: number + (13 Γ consecutive prime numbers starting from 2) Therefore, 184 should come in place of 186.
